# Struct [tauri_api](/docs/api/rust/tauri_api/index.html)::[Error](/docs/api/rust/tauri_api/)
pub struct Error(pub ErrorKind, _);
The Error type.
This tuple struct is made of two elements:
- an `ErrorKind` which is used to determine the type of the error.
- An internal `State`, not meant for direct use outside of `error_chain` internals, containing:
- a backtrace, generated when the error is created.
- an error chain, used for the implementation of `Error::cause()`.
## Methods
### `impl Error`
#### `pub fn from_kind(kind: ErrorKind) -> Error`
Constructs an error from a kind, and generates a backtrace.
#### `pub fn with_chain<E, K>(error: E, kind: K) -> Errorwhere E: Error + Send + 'static, K: Into<ErrorKind>,`
Constructs a chained error from another error and a kind, and generates a backtrace.
#### `pub fn with_boxed_chain<K>( error: Box<dyn Error + 'static + Send>, kind: K ) -> Errorwhere K: Into<ErrorKind>,`
Construct a chained error from another boxed error and a kind, and generates a backtrace
#### `pub fn kind(&self) -> &ErrorKind`
Returns the kind of the error.
#### `pub fn iter(&self) -> Iter`
Iterates over the error chain.
#### `pub fn backtrace(&self) -> Option<&Backtrace>`
Returns the backtrace associated with this error.
#### `pub fn chain_err<F, EK>(self, error: F) -> Errorwhere EK: Into<ErrorKind>, F: FnOnce() -> EK,`
Extends the error chain with a new entry.
#### `pub fn description(&self) -> &str`
A short description of the error. This method is identical to [`Error::description()`](https://doc.rust-lang.org/nightly/std/error/trait.Error.html#tymethod.description)
